Throughout 2017, you will see celebratory signs of our 35th year, kicked off with our IREC@35 event in Washington, DC, March 8th. It was an extraordinary evening with IREC friends, supporters and partners during which we reveled in our collective achievements, and acknowledged the legendary accomplishments of our dear friend and respected colleague, IREC President Emeritus Jane Weissman.

We also had the pleasure of honoring two distinctive 2017 IREC Energy Heroes: U.S. Senator Ed Markey (D-MA) and  Congressman Paul Tonko (D-NY). 

We released a new report the same day, IREC IMPACT@35, which highlights the top 8 results of IREC’s impactful work over more than three decades, along with a complementary Impact@35 Timeline.

Our regulatory and workforce teams are busy polishing up several new resources and initiatives, for policymakers, industry and allied industry professionals. While you’ll see these released in the coming months, one new resource is posted here, Five Guiding Principles for Shared Renewable Energy, a new addition to the IREC Model Rules for Shared Renewable Energy Programs.
